Timothy Stackpole was a New York Firefighter, who was severely burned in a 1998 fire. After he recovered, he returned to the force despite the advice of some friends and family and the fact that he could retire comfortably. He was a great firefighter and passionate about his work and was soon promoted to captain. Timothy was one of the firefighters that ran into the second tower to try to save some people. When he did, it collapsed and took his life. He knew his calling—to save people.

The promises of God can be found in the word of God. “There are approximately 8,810 promises in the entire Bible. In the Old Testament, there are 7,706 and in the New Testament, there are 1,104 wonderful promises. Deuteronomy 28 has 133 promises, which is more than any other chapter in the Bible. (Vance Havner- Encyclopedia of Illustrations #4612). Below are twelve of those promises.


God's presence -- "I will never leave you" (Heb. 13:5)

God's protection -- "I am your shield" (Gen. 15:1)

God's power -- "I will strengthen you" (Isa. 41:10)

God's provision -- "I will help you" (Isa. 41:10)

God's leading -- "When he has brought out all his own, he goes before them" (John 10:4)

God's purposes -- "I know the plans I have for you, declares the Lord, plans to prosper you and not to harm you, plans to give you hope and a future" (Jer. 29:11)

God's rest -- "Come to Me, all you who are burdened, and I will give you rest" (Matt. 11:28)

God's cleansing -- "If we confess our sins, He is faithful and just to forgive us our sins, and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ness" (1 John 1:9)

God's goodness -- "No good thing will He withhold from those whose walk is blameless" (Psalm 84:11)

God's faithfulness -- "The Lord will not forsake His people for His great name's sake" (1 Sam. 12:22)

God's guidance -- "The meek will He guide" (Psalm 25:9)

God's wise plan -- "All things work together for good to those that love God" (Rom. 8:28)
